In the heart of the Abruzzo summer, the small municipality of Montebello sul Sangro, in the province of Chieti, renews its most cherished tradition: the Patronal Feast of Santa Giusta and San Ciriaco. The event takes place in early August, when the village overlooking the Sangro Valley and Lake Bomba dresses up to honor its saints. Santa Giusta is celebrated on August 7th, while August 8th is dedicated to San Ciriaco, the town's patron saint.
The religious heart of the festival is the Holy Mass and the solemn procession that winds through the village streets, accompanied by the entire community. Devotion to the patron saints is rooted in the centuries-old history of this mountain village, once known as Buonanotte, whose old town still preserves the charming Church of Santa Giusta.
Alongside the religious observances, the festivities offer a rich entertainment program. The days are enlivened by recreational events designed for all ages, while the evenings come alive with two dance parties hosted in Piazza San Ciriaco. The festivities are framed by the unmissable fireworks displays: the opening fireworks that announce the start of the festival and the final pyrotechnic show organized by the municipality, illuminating the sky over the Sangro Valley.
Situated at an altitude of about 810 meters on a ridge overlooking the Sangro Valley, Montebello sul Sangro is one of the smallest municipalities in the province of Chieti and all of Abruzzo. Its patronal feast is a precious opportunity to rediscover the identity of this mountain community and to reunite: many emigrants and descendants of the town return during these summer days. Montebello sul Sangro is located in the hinterland of the province of Chieti, in Abruzzo, above the Sangro Valley and near Lake Bomba. By car, it can be reached from the Fondovalle Sangro (SS 652); the reference motorway exit is Val di Sangro on the A14, then continue inland.
